Output 112f7e0e288dc2a07cf512a21fae46dfc64a4c67b95bc9f3fef363a04a9f756f:3

value
266868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eee20b465856ac83680b5503e4b1b5a2c8d0430c OP_EQUAL
address
3PU7Y1oysb4eax6AS5EUkVv14TCvNk5oDL
transaction
112f7e0e288dc2a07cf512a21fae46dfc64a4c67b95bc9f3fef363a04a9f756f
spent
true